England will take on South Africa in the ongoing ICC Women's World Cup on Friday, October 03. This will be the first game for both these teams, and without doubt, both these sides will look to deliver the first blows. England enters this event as one of the favorites to win the showpiece event, owing to their sheer class and depth. Meanwhile, the Proteas are dark horses, having shown admirable growth in the last three years.
The Laura Wolvaardt-led South Africa have reached two consecutive Women's T20 World Cup finals, and also managed to reach the semis of the 50-over World Cup in 2022. Their skipper is one of the best batter's going around, and also has a calm presence in the field. The team also got ample time to get used to sub-continent conditions. They beat Pakistan 2-1 and are ready to battle it with the tougher teams.

ENG-W vs SA-W: Match Preview
England have changed leadership, with their long-standing captain Heather Knight making way for all-rounder Nat Sciver-Brunt. However, the skipper said that she can blindly rely on inputs provided by her predecessor as she brings a lot of value in the new-look young England team. The core group remains the same, as along with duo, the team also has opener Tammy Beaumont, Danni Wyatt-Hodge, and Sophie Ecclestone.
There are quite few young players as well, as Lauren Bell, Charlie Dean, and Sophia Dunkley who bring lot of value to the team. On the other hand, South Africa's core group from the last 50-over World Cup also remains the same as Wolvaardt, Marizane Kaap, Chloe Tryon, and Sune Luus are match-winners on their own right. Add to this list, is the in-form opener Tazmin Britt's, who has scored four centuries this calendar year.

Batting is no doubt the strength of this Proteas side. However, they also have good bowlers in the pace and spin departments. With the men's team finally winning a major silverware in 2025, the women's team will look to replicate the same in the Women's World Cup.
